Summary

This document sets out the Environment Agency's strategy for managing the flood defences of the Humber Estuary over the next 50 years. The overall objectives of the plan are to develop a coherent and realistic plan for the estuary's flood defence, and to ensure that all proposals are technically, economically, environmentally and socially acceptable and viable.
